Buyers Guide: Things to Look Out For Before Making a Purchase

Suppose you’re looking for the best hedge trimmer for boxwood.

In that case, you’ll need to consider the power source (electric or gas), the motor, the blade sizes, and whether you should use an electric or gas model.

If you want to keep your yard looking great while also establishing a well-kept privacy boundary, here are factors to keep in mind.

  • Power Source

When evaluating the best hedge trimmer, gas and electric hedge trimmers are the two most common power sources to consider.

In most cases, the decision is based on the requirements for power and portability.

In general, gas-powered hedge trimmers work harder than their electric counterparts because they require both oil and gas in order to run.

However, having more power comes at a price in terms of weight: Trimming tall bushes with gas hedge trimmers can be difficult due to their weight.

Although electric hedge trimmers don’t have as much power as gas-powered versions, they are lighter, making them easier to operate at chest height or higher.

Corded models may not be the best option for bigger yards, as they must be plugged into an outlet for continuous operation.

However, cordless trimmers give you complete mobility as long as the batteries are constantly renewed or changed.

  • Engine Power

Hedge trimmer blades can cut through leaves, twigs, and small branches thanks to the engine’s power.

Depending on the model of power hedge trimmer, the method used to determine engine power varies.

To monitor the amount of energy flowing through the electric engine, electric hedge trimmers have an amperage (amps) gauge.

The engine’s output increases in direct proportion to the amperage input. The majority of electric hedge trimmers operate at 2.5 to 4.5 amps.

The voltage rating of battery-powered hedge trimmers is often linked to the battery’s amount of power stored and produced.

Hedge trimmer batteries typically have a voltage of 20 volts, although some have as much as 80 volts.

The engine power of gas hedge trimmers is measured in cubic centimeters (ccs).

The displacement of air and fuel by the engine is quantified by this unit.

It’s more powerful the more ccs an engine has. Engine displacement for gas hedge trimmers typically ranges from 21 to 25 cubic centimeters.

  • Blade Size

Single- or double-sided blades are available in lengths ranging from 13 inches to 40 inches.

Hedge-trimming can be made considerably easier if the proper blade size is selected.

Small hedges, weeds, and shrubs prevalent in residential gardens can all benefit from a blade size of 18 inches or less.

The average user will benefit most from blades ranging from 19 to 30 inches. Unfortunately, large shrubs, full-size hedges, and small tree limbs are no match for them.

Because most single-sided blades are designed for right-handed users, those left-handed may prefer to utilize a power hedge trimmer with a double-sided blade.

  • Cutting Capacity

Another thing to keep in mind is how thick a branch can be cut using the trimmer.

More powerful models can usually handle branches up to an inch in diameter.

In contrast, most models can handle branches up to half an inch thick. A blade’s tooth gap should be no more than one-half inch in width.

The bigger the space between the blades, the greater the cutting power.

Leaf, twig, and tiny branch trimming can be accomplished with most home trimmers that have a gap between 3/8 and 3/4 of an inch.

Some commercially available trimmers have blade gaps of more than 1 inch, which allow them to tackle small trees and big hedges with ease.
